How to Verify Atomic Helm's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— Review the repository security policy, open issues, and recent commits for signs of active maintenance.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Atomic Helm's dependency tree.
  3. รีวิว permissions — Understand what access Atomic Helm requ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Atomic Helm in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=Atomic Helm
  6. ตรวจสอบ license — Confirm that Atomic Helm's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ses security concerns openly. Low community engagement may indicate limited peer review of the codebase.

Common Safety Concerns with Atomic Helm

When evaluating whether Atomic Helm is safe, consider these category-specific risks:

Data handling

Understand how Atomic Helm processes, stores, and transmits your data. Review the tool's privacy policy and data retention practices, especially for sensitive or proprietary information.

Dependency security

Check Atomic Helm's dependency tree for known vulnerabilities. Tools with outdated or unmaintained dependencies pose a higher security risk.

Update frequency

Regularly check for updates to Atomic Helm. Security patches and bug fixes are only effective if you're running the latest version.

Third-party integrations

If Atomic Helm connects to external APIs or services, each integration point is a potential attack surface. Audit all third-party connections, verify that data shared with external services is minimized, and ensure that integration credentials are rotated regularly.

License and IP compliance

Verify that Atomic Helm's license is compatible with your intended use case. Some AI tools have restrictive licenses that limit commercial use, redistribution, or derivative works. Using Atomic Helm in violation of its license can expose your organization to legal liability.

Best Practices for Using Atomic Helm Safely

Whether you're an individual developer or an enterprise team, these practices will help you get the most from Atomic Helm while minimizing risk:

Conduct regular audits

Periodically review how Atomic Helm is used in your workflow. Check for unexpected behavior, permissions drift, and compliance with your security policies.

Keep dependencies updated

Ensure Atomic Helm and all its dependencies are running the latest stable versions to benefit from security patches.

Follow least privilege

Grant Atomic Helm only the minimum permissions it needs to function. Avoid granting admin or root access.

Monitor for security advisories

Subscribe to Atomic Helm's security advisories and vulnerability disclosures. Use Nerq's API to get automated trust score updates.

Document usage policies

Create and maintain a clear policy for how Atomic Helm is used within your organization, including data handling guidelines and acceptable use cases.
